Seems that there are two ways to go.

Put back the Carbon and MacOS modules into 3.0.
Use Python 2 to build the python 3 package.

I've converted it back to 2.x for the time being. Eventually, I think
some 3.x bindings should be released.

For the record: I was my intention that the build-installer.py script works with /usr/bin/python on OSX 10.4 or later. That makes it possible to create a usable installer without first having to build a bootstrap version of python.
